About Weatherbar

Originally founded as a draught-proofing company, Weatherbar has been proudly established for over 40 years. Initially acquired by Parallel to meet the growing demand for quality home improvement products, as the market for draught-proofing shifted, Weatherbar too altered its course to meet the demand of DIY-ers, Grand Designers, and keen home improvement beginners.

Today, Weatherbar specialises in providing responsibly sourced wooden products, focusing on hardwood, with a selection of softwood products also manufactured in-house. Situated in rural Lincolnshire, the expertise of our team lies in taking high-quality manufactured hardwood—both solid and engineered—and finishing it to meet your specifications on-site, by hand, the way they always have been; allowing us to deliver custom solutions that suit an entirely unique range of design needs.

As a leading provider of hardwood mouldings, our team of craftsmen not only ensure an unrivalled attention to detail but also prioritises sustainability. Our timber is all sourced from certified, accredited and responsibly managed forests. Our History

A family-run business since day one, with roots going back to a humble garden shed, Weatherbar was founded by Tony Bell, now our Chair. From its small beginnings, the company as it stands has grown year-on-year under his guidance.

Parallel acquired Weatherbar from John Bainbridge 20 years ago and today, the Weatherbar brand sits in the hands of Tony's son, Graeme - our Managing Director - who leads the business alongside his father and mother - our Finance Director - making Weatherbar a true family affair.

From Those Early Days.....

Weatherbar has expanded steadily and now operates from a 30,000-square-foot facility, which the team has called home for the last three years.

With six full-time staff in the office and seven in the factory, all working together to deliver high-quality hardwood mouldings and profiles to our customers, the team of experts on-site has grown too.

For the past ten years, the Parallel Group has seen year-on-year growth, and today, proudly supplies 95% of the UK’s biggest flooring manufacturers, providing them with white-label products to take to market. And that's only the beginning.
